    Fantastico Problem...

    Okay, here's my issue. I simply want to install a clean copy of Coppermine, but I want it to install to a second level directory so that it can be accessed through a multi-hosted domain...it doesn't seem to want to let me do that.

    I'm sure it's a quick fix...at least I hope it is...any suggestions?

    In my CP I can pick from a list of all of my subdomains and multihosted domains and then optionally I can specify a second level directory under that.

    So, for example:

    domain mainsite.com w/ no directory would install in public_html
    domain mainsite.com w/ gallery directory would install in public_html/gallery
    domain multihost .com w/ no directory would install in public_html/multihost
    domain multihost.com w/ gallery directory would install in public_html/multihost/gallery

    I hope this makes sense. Are you seeing the same thing as I am? I haven't actually tried doing an install, although I installed a couple other packages from Fantastico recently and they worked flawlessly. What are you trying to do and are you getting any error messages?
